Worldwide Express expands operations in Nuevo León

NUEVO LEON - The leading transportation and logistics company Worldwide Express Operations LLC, inaugurated its offices in Nuevo León and announced that it will make an annual investment of US$85 million by 2025.

Headquartered in Dallas, Texas, the company continues its growth and consolidation strategy in North America, strengthening its presence in the region and taking advantage of the state's competitive advantages.

'Nuevo León has consolidated itself as a key strategic center for the logistics industry, due to its infrastructure and qualified talent, which is why we are excited that more companies like Worldwide Express are coming to the state and contributing to economic development,' mentioned Emmanuel Loo, in charge of dispatch for the Ministry of Economy.

In total, more than 400 new positions in logistics and administration will be generated.

"Since 2016, Worldwide Express has invested around US$60 million in Nuevo León," highlighted Tom Madine, Chief Executive Officer of Worldwide Express.

He also reaffirmed its commitment to the development of the logistics industry in Mexico, driving innovation and generating opportunities for growth in the region.

The company currently has a presence in Monterrey, Mexico City, Guadalajara, Chihuahua and Querétaro.

Worldwide Express is a leading transportation and logistics solutions company with a global team of more than 2,500 employees in the U.S., Mexico and Canada that optimizes supply chains through advanced technology and efficient service.
